Subject: Key rotation for SlimCrate — heads up

Hi Mirela,

Quick note for your review queue: we rotated the API key for SlimCrate, our container image slimming service, as part of the quarterly schedule. Nothing dramatic — the old key was never exposed, we're just staying on cadence. The Brindleford build agents have already picked up the new credential, and the layer-pruning jobs ran clean overnight. Old key gets revoked Friday, so flag anything still using it before then. For your records, the new key is:

gateway credential: kto23_dolYgAScEh2TaPOlStqOl98

Following a detailed occupancy and cost review, the Dunmarsh office is recommended for closure at lease expiry. Headcount of eleven will be offered relocation to Caverleigh or remote arrangements; severance exposure is modest. Annualised savings cover rent, facilities, and local support contracts. Client coverage in the region will continue through the field team. Transition planning begins next month. The wider restructuring context appears in the confidential note below.

management briefing: The renewal with Zoraelax Group closes at $10 million a year, 15 percent below the last contract. Project Ralael slips by six weeks because of the audit delay.

## FD Leak Hunt: Parcelwright Gateway

Since Tuesday, the Parcelwright gateway has been leaking file descriptors at roughly 40/hour, tripping the ulimit around day three of uptime. Current mitigation is a rolling restart every 48 hours via the Cogwheel scheduler. To pull per-process descriptor snapshots from the Fathom profiler and attach them to the sync notes, authenticate to the profiler's internal endpoint with the key below.

app token of tagef-tafog = qvz3-7n0